Behavioural Referrals Veterinary Practice offers a referral service in small animal behavioural medicine.

Practice Principal Sarah Heath BVSs DipECVBM-CA CCAB MRCVS and the supporting team, offer a comprehensive service in the diagnosis, treatment and management of behavioural disorders. The tailor-made behavioural modification programmes are complemented by a follow up service provided by the team of rehabilitation trainers.

  • Only positive, reward based methods are used in our behaviour modification programmes.
  • We do not approve of the use of aversive techniques or gadgets, such as shock collars, rattle cans and choke chains.
  • Behavioural Referrals will only accept behavioural cases that have been referred by a veterinary surgeon.
  • Pet insurance companies may cover a behavioural referral. Pet plan provide preauthorisation forms that can be completed prior to the appointment
